I've taken photographs on and off throughout my life, but it wasn't until 2010 or so that I became more interested in photography as a hobby. I had a small Canon PowerShot that I took with me on my walks on the beach (at the San Francisco coast). That's when I learned to look for details and interesting objects. One day I saw a little glistering thing on the beach sand and when I bend down I saw what looked like a water drop. Luckily my camera had a macro setting so I took a picture and noticed that it was actually a tiny jellyfish shaped like a basket ball. The photo clearly shows the kernels of sand on the beach which gives a sense of scale. I don't think it was longer than a quarter inch.

Camera: Canon PowerShot SX230 HS

Unfortunately, this camera was far from dust proof and the sandy conditions of the beach pretty soon interfered with its functioning. But the good thing was that my interest in photography had been rekindled sufficiently that it let me to buy a series of better cameras over time.
